Max Leroy Anderson (September 10, 1934 – June 27, 1983) was an American hot air balloonist and businessman. Along with Ben Abruzzo, his frequent ballooning partner, he helped Albuquerque become known as the balloon capital of the world. He was responsible for the first nonstop balloon crossing of the Atlantic Ocean and of the United States.
